NET and SET Recruitment: In Indian universities and colleges, the UGC NET and SET exams will be held in 2022 to determine eligibility for Assistant Professor and Junior Research Fellowship positions. The NET exam was previously administered by CBSE, but now the NTA (National Testing Agency) is in charge on behalf of the UGC (University Grants Commission).

The number of subjects available for the NET and SET exams differs significantly. Because state tests have fewer subjects that vary from state to state, whereas the NET exam has a larger number of subjects that are applicable across the country. UGC NET Exam 2022: An Overview

It is one of India’s most difficult exams. It takes place twice a year (in June and December). It is held by the National Testing Agency (NTA) to recruit Assistant Professors and Junior Research Fellows in UGC-approved universities. The following are the highlights of the UGC NET Exam 2022:

UGC SET Exams 2022: An Overview

To select eligible candidates for assistant professor or lecturer positions in state-owned institutions, each state conducts its own State Eligibility Test. Exams for the SET are usually held once a year. For more information, see the SET exams listed below.

Difference Between NET & SET Recruitment

Many candidates are confused about the differences between the NET and SET exams, but they are both used to recruit Assistant Professors, lecturers, and researchers in national and state-level institutions.

There are some significant differences between the NET and SET Exams, which candidates can understand using the table below:

Parameters of ComparisonNET ExamSET ExamConducting AuthorityIt is a national level exam that is administered by national bodies such as the NTA, UGC, and ICAR.It is a state-level exam administered by state-controlled organisations. Generally, each state has its own authority that administers the exam.
Exam FrequencyUGC NET & CSIR NET is conducted twice a year while ASRB NET is conducted once a year.These exams are conducted once a year.
Exam PurposeThese exams are for candidates who want to work as lecturers, professors, or researchers at national or state level institutions.These exams should be taken by candidates who want to work as an Assistant Professor or Lecturer in a state-owned institution.
Syllabus For 81 subjects, the UGC NET is administered. CSIR NET is for science stream candidates, whereas ASRB NET is for agricultural studies candidates.These are run by state-owned commissions with their own curriculum. This article contains the exam syllabus for a few of the exams.
EligibilityFor JRF under UGC NET, the age limit is 30 years, and for JRF under CSIR NET, the age limit is 28 years.

For lectureship, there is no age limit.

There is no age limit for the ASRB NET Exam

For UGC NET and CSIR NET, a Master’s Degree with at least 55 percent from any recognized university in the General Category and 50 percent in the other categories is required.

For ASRB NET, a Master’s Degree from any recognized university is required.
There is no age limit.

Candidates must have received at least a 55 percent grade in their Master’s degree from a UGC-accredited university.
Exam PatternUGC NET: It consists of two papers (Paper I and Paper II), with a total duration of three hours.
Paper I is worth 100 marks, while Paper II is worth 200 marks.
There are no negative marks.

CSIR NET: It is divided into three sections and lasts a total of three hours.
There will be a total of 200 marks awarded.
Each subject has a different marking scheme.
There will be negative marking, and it will be different for each subject.

ASRB NET: It only has one paper with 150 multiple-choice questions and a time limit of two hours. The ASRB NET exam has negative marking.
It is also conducted in 2 papers (Paper I & Paper-II).
The exam will last 3 hours total, whether it is done in two sessions on the same day or in two separate sessions.
The exam consists of 150 multiple-choice questions worth a total of 300 marks.
There are no negative marks..
Exam LanguageThe NET exams are offered in both English and Hindi.The SET Exams are also available in state languages.

MH SET 2022 Exam

The Savitribai Phule Pune University will conduct the Maharastra State Eligibility Test, or MH SET, entrance exam for Lectureship and Assistant Professor eligibility. This exam is held in 15 different cities across the state in 32 different subjects. On most days, the MH SET examination is held in two sessions on the same day. NET and SET Recruitment FAQs

Who is qualified to take the NET Exam?

You can apply for the NET Exam 2022 if you have a post-graduate degree.

What is the procedure for applying for the NET Exam?

The NTA website is where you can apply for the NET Exam.

What are the benefits of taking the NET Exam?

By taking the NET Exam, you will be considered for Assistant Professor and Junior Research Fellowship positions all around the country.

How many times does the NET Exam take place each year?

The NET Exams take place twice a year.
